Cambourne is a thriving settlement of three villages, Great Cambourne, Lower Cambourne and Upper Cambourne, located 10 miles east of Cambridge with direct transport links to the City and other surrounding towns such as St Neots and Huntingdon. Over the years the town has expanded and is now very much self contained, with a large Morrisons, Home Bargains, various cafe`s, pubs and takeaways. There are a wide selection of schools to choose from, including four primary schools and Cambourne Village College for secondary education. The villages are surrounded by beautiful woodland and country walks to nearby lakes and nature reserves, making this is truly pleasant area to live.
